I am a "2 battery type guy" but I would save the weight and go with one. There are posts and articles on wiring and if you want to isolate your electronics, a manual switch just for them would suffice. Click it off just when you are starting and then back on again. Starting will not affect navigation lights, bilges, etc... I have a "fixed" vhf (fixed is a misname, I remove mine from the mount and the other wires are set up to easily disconnect) as well as a hand held. Hand held's are inexpensive and having two devices is a nice safety feature aside from weather. Others are more knowledgeable about kickers.
